Understanding the Basics: What Exactly is AWS?

So, what is AWS in simple terms? At its core, AWS provides on-demand cloud computing platforms to individuals, companies, and governments, on a metered pay-as-you-go basis. Imagine a giant Lego set, with all sorts of different blocks (services) you can use to build whatever you need. AWS offers a wide array of services that cover everything from basic computing, storage, and databases to advanced technologies like machine learning, artificial intelligence, and Internet of Things (IoT). When you use AWS, you're tapping into Amazon's vast infrastructure, including data centers located all over the world. This global presence ensures that you can deploy your applications and services close to your users, reducing latency and improving performance. One of the main benefits is its scalability. Need more computing power? You can scale up your resources in minutes. No longer are you stuck with the limitations of physical hardware. This agility allows businesses to respond quickly to market changes and innovate without being constrained by infrastructure limitations. AWS offers a pay-as-you-go model, which means you only pay for the services you use. This can significantly reduce costs compared to traditional IT infrastructure, where you have to invest in hardware and software upfront. Furthermore, AWS takes care of the underlying infrastructure, including security, maintenance, and updates. This frees up your IT team to focus on more strategic initiatives rather than managing servers and networks.

Key Components of AWS

AWS is made up of a wide variety of services. Some of the most popular include:

  • Compute: Amazon Elastic Compute Cloud (EC2) provides virtual servers; AWS Lambda lets you run code without managing servers.
  • Storage: Amazon Simple Storage Service (S3) offers scalable object storage; Amazon Elastic Block Storage (EBS) provides block storage for EC2 instances.
  • Databases: Amazon Relational Database Service (RDS) provides managed relational databases; Amazon DynamoDB is a NoSQL database.
  • Networking: Amazon Virtual Private Cloud (VPC) lets you create isolated networks; Amazon Route 53 is a DNS web service.
  • Analytics: Amazon Redshift is a data warehouse service; Amazon EMR is a big data processing service.

Each of these services is designed to be flexible and customizable, allowing you to build exactly the systems you need. AWS regularly adds new services, expanding its capabilities and keeping up with the latest technological advancements. This rapid pace of innovation is one of the things that makes AWS so exciting.

Monitor and Optimize

Once you've launched your resources, it's essential to monitor them and optimize your costs. AWS provides tools for monitoring your resource usage, performance, and costs. You can use CloudWatch to monitor metrics, set up alarms, and analyze logs. The AWS Cost Explorer allows you to track your spending and identify areas where you can reduce costs. Regularly review your resource usage and adjust your configurations as needed. Use the right-sizing tools to ensure that your instances are appropriately sized for your workloads. This will ensure you're getting the best performance and cost efficiency.

Hosting Websites and Applications

AWS provides a powerful platform for hosting websites and applications of all sizes. You can easily launch and manage virtual servers (EC2 instances) and scale them up or down based on your traffic demands. AWS offers a wide range of services to support your web applications, including load balancing, content delivery networks (CDNs), and databases. You can use S3 to store your static website content, such as images and videos, and integrate it with CloudFront, AWS's CDN, to deliver content quickly to users worldwide. For more complex applications, you can use services like Elastic Beanstalk or AWS Amplify, which simplify the deployment and management of your applications. AWS's robust infrastructure and global network of data centers ensure high availability and performance for your web applications.

Data Storage and Backup

AWS offers a variety of storage solutions to meet your needs, from simple object storage to block storage and archival storage. S3 is a popular choice for storing files, images, videos, and other types of data. It provides high durability, availability, and scalability. EBS is designed for block storage, which is ideal for databases and applications that require low-latency storage. Glacier is a low-cost archival storage service suitable for long-term data preservation. AWS also provides tools for data backup and disaster recovery. You can use services like AWS Backup to create and manage backups of your data and EC2 instances. With AWS's robust storage and backup solutions, you can protect your data and ensure business continuity.

Database Management

AWS provides a wide range of database services to support your applications. RDS allows you to run managed relational databases, such as MySQL, PostgreSQL, and SQL Server. DynamoDB is a NoSQL database suitable for applications that require high performance and scalability. Amazon Aurora is a MySQL and PostgreSQL-compatible database with improved performance and cost-effectiveness. AWS also offers specialized database services, such as Redshift, which is designed for data warehousing and analytics. AWS's database services simplify database management tasks, such as provisioning, patching, and backups, allowing you to focus on your application's logic. You can choose the database service that best meets your performance, scalability, and cost requirements.

Machine Learning and AI

AWS offers a comprehensive suite of machine learning and artificial intelligence (AI) services to help you build and deploy intelligent applications. SageMaker is a fully managed service that allows you to build, train, and deploy machine learning models. AWS also provides pre-trained AI services, such as Amazon Rekognition for image and video analysis, Amazon Lex for building chatbots, and Amazon Polly for text-to-speech conversion. You can integrate these AI services into your applications to add features like image recognition, natural language processing, and personalized recommendations. AWS makes it easy to get started with machine learning and AI, even if you don't have extensive expertise in these fields.

Big Data Analytics

AWS provides a robust platform for big data analytics. Services like EMR allow you to process large datasets using popular big data frameworks such as Hadoop and Spark. Redshift is a data warehouse service designed for fast and efficient data analysis. AWS also offers a range of other services for data ingestion, transformation, and visualization. You can use services like Kinesis to process real-time data streams and QuickSight to create interactive dashboards. AWS's big data analytics services help you extract valuable insights from your data, enabling you to make data-driven decisions.
